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Bug] Clicking the X in the corner a floating tile goniometer in the popup window interface after disabling the component crashes HISE #415

Closed
aaronventure opened this issue Aug 19, 2023 · 2 comments

Comments

@aaronventure
Copy link

  1. Add Floating tile.
  2. Add Analyser FX. Make it a goniometer.
  3. Connect it to the floating tile.
  4. Open popup window View > Add floating window. Add Script Content to show your plugin interface.
  5. Focus script editor and hit F5 to comple.
  6. Little X shows up in the top right corner of the interface in the floating in the popup window
  7. Click X. Nothing happens.
  8. Disable the floating tile in the interface editor by clicking on it and setting its "enable" parameter to off.
  9. Focus script, hit F5 to compile. The panel in the popup goes red when hovering the X.
  10. Click the little X in the interface. Not the one in the popup window corner but the plugin interface corner in the popup window.
  11. I have become death, destroyer of intricate scripting editor tab setups.

HiseSnippet 1159.3oc2W0jaaaDEdnkm.KYmllhDztjvnKb.bCDkSSKZWDYaI4JzHaAK23rKXL4SRCL4LDjCssZP1zU93ziPNB8HziPuAsugT+LzgQPUn0MoZggmu27H+d+8MC6FIcg3XYDwp7IiBAh0FzdiDpg6OjwEj1MHVeBsCKVAQ1YP6MJjEGCdDKqRGnArJuJI82e7r8X9LgKLChPdgj6BOmGvUyP6V+G499sXdvI7.ic+j5sckh8k9xDjOknUIgL2yYCfCY5ssBkXcmldbkLpmhofXh0p6I8F0an7RQ19eAOlelOnW3P5gOnL3VReOMi0nj8Gx885NItiIDKZ2YYgRYYgGP6v83SwmkM9zTC1y7vLeXsRd5UJG8bLoWUC5U.krLnzpYT59zdtQ7P0LKZ9rNss.KN8YXZ2jJY6kX8V59RbCB0iCXmCshvEScXqmVs5113edz22OQ3p3RgsTbnTAGI15QUdckxUdSE6aZpe+BsoeMQReeHpPy5Jcz7bbKQRvYPz11Wv7SfoaDC+74T56OmZVxcyhZiMJEsEb0Qgf380HPFmpv+6mZ2foX5BwXLbegPjhqofUC3BrqNqrTl1.hOWICwFz8kAgRg9IXstJ05cmTzXBvmvwRyZzz+2gbk4XxHyEmMXxLP467m3OMFWAAyPQfafVyDVAWod2GwkbO0voum29K0GB7ACUlHffg4xzFHhQvrgZ7PQVvzxWxTbwfS3XdWGS2iZBMuPaA3PZh2pC80Urs2bZ4os2lem8lGHEbY.f8uats1bagGbEZnZ5JbL2Wd4oxnyiQgC.w6y7igJuYRgMqhcO5tIdb4tBl+nXHJW5dmc1ofz80WecQo6FMZTP5dRnRd2QXT7P5k3yT4UTzxniMfiD4Fi0yphXtZjoL6+XxLKJEuOsKW4NrXNtRAbDGb92fiiEmuKsY+9fqZFAWk15k2BJwzr2eE5zdG8KeC5r1xbjXuDjlQ83+rwYb+Z8tQn5Ab4X0iIIr5VkVXF6L+D1wxD8nXGlJhiShzCSB5g8lt.luDnziVD0ZEsbW15p50ZNzCDdoKzJFiM5nWaM1nyDilEkGlEIqSOkcAjd2gzrxCSW2WFEXe.HfHcGkybt8vusn2dHbgu8vQtJjBmDwDwgxXTWx3IeCa0Ls0.TIh7aOCJ2tzgWKL7L12Z0m.VyDDE7y8vv04dRc3FBl+9yZlJB2Cvnw6nXWLX04NSAftInr1oZoTGSGmAWyD9GXQdXcwM23Yo4cQJmk7hT24CtKR8QfHbNElxS3XOdPnOzTbA3iW7HkieFdSi9rDe0Dz7iScjBY3PTIJWg9X.UAFL.x0+TX.sqRg21dFxCpeL3CrXiQrur9y4BfEg4IXIyEN+su2ag0quflQWasFf8GuGdV5+0Gdt3SenD3G1UwOmhRw0rSKk1+2TKuMNW+13cDvbijuxM6y9zC8qkhfwsH867KS6nWa6PR+TPzOZ0GWkDfGW7JWWc+5Wgm9TrO0VBe1YI74IKgOe8R3ySWBe9lkvmuct9nOod2DkLHqmGA51L6yzrZZ7Ei+EM9QyzB

Here's a snippet to skip the first 3 steps. Proceed from 4 onward.

x gon give it to ya

3235dac

christoph-hart pushed a commit that referenced this issue Sep 13, 2023
@christoph-hart
Copy link
Collaborator

The close button had no reason to appear in the first place anyway, so I just made sure it doesn't show up so that the destroyer of intricate scripting editor setups will stay lurking in the eternal darkness to never walk on the face of earth again.

@aaronventure
Copy link
Author

May the universe heed your words.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ants